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Bare-tailed Woolly Opossum | Galapagos sea lion |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(hewan) | Animalia (hewan)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class same | Mammalia (mamalia) | Mammalia (mamalia) |
| Order | Didelphimorphia (Didelphimorphia) | Carnivora (Carnivorans) |
| Family | Didelphidae | Otariidae |
| Genus | Caluromys | Zalophus |
| Species | Caluromys philander | Zalophus wollebaeki |
Evolutionary Relationship
Bare-tailed Woolly Opossum and Galapagos sea lion share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(mamalia)
